The most well liked March in India on document was adopted by extra waves of oppressive warmth in April, leaving greater than a billion individuals sweltering and the monsoon season nonetheless weeks away.
A extreme heatwave in mid- and late April 2022 introduced temperatures 4.5 to eight.5°C (8 to fifteen°F) above common in east, central, and northwest India—simply weeks after the nation recorded its hottest March for the reason that nation’s meteorological division started maintaining information greater than 120 years in the past.
On April 27, 2022, the very best temperature within the nation, 45.9°C (114.6°F), was recorded in Prayagraj in Uttar Pradesh. The day earlier than, a excessive of 45.1°C (113.2°F) was reported at Barmer in West Rajasthan within the northwest, based on the India Meteorological Division. Many different localities recorded temperatures of 42-44°C (108-111°F).
The map on the prime of this text exhibits modeled air temperatures on April 27, 2022. It was derived from the Goddard Earth Observing System (GEOS) mannequin and represents air temperatures at 2 meters (about 6.5 ft) above the bottom.
The results of the heatwave embrace heat-related diseases, poor air high quality, little rainfall, and diminished crop yields. Moreover, energy consumption has spiked and coal inventories have dropped, leaving the nation with its worst electrical energy scarcity in additional than six years. Within the northern areas of Uttarakhand and Himachal Pradesh, mountain snow has been quickly melting. As well as, greater than 300 massive wildfires had been burning across the nation on April 27, based on the Forest Survey of India. Practically a 3rd of these had been within the state of Uttarakhand.
A bulge within the jet stream and a dome of excessive strain have stored an unseasonably heat, dry air mass parked over the nation, based on meteorologists. The heatwave circumstances had been anticipated to accentuate within the subsequent few days and persist for no less than one other week.
Heatwaves are frequent in India within the spring and early summer time, particularly in Might, which is usually the most popular month. However they're typically relieved by the onset of the monsoon season from late Might by September. The variety of spring heatwaves has been rising, based on India’s Ministry of Earth Sciences, as 12 of the nation’s 15 warmest years on document have occurred since 2006. A June 2015 heatwave killed greater than 2,000 individuals.
